关于 KEDA | Kubernetes Event-driven Autoscalingh

KEDA.sh是一个开源平台,旨在简化Kubernetes上无服务器应用程序的部署和管理。它为无服务器应用程序提供自动缩放、事件驱动和监控功能。

利用KEDA.sh,开发者可以:

  • 自动缩放:根据请求或事件调整无服务器函数的实例数量。
  • 事件驱动:使用事件源(例如Kafka、RabbitMQ)触发函数的执行。
  • 监控和警报:监控函数的性能,并在出现问题时发出警报。
  • 服务发现:自动发现和路由请求到无服务器函数。
  • 版本控制:轻松部署和回滚函数版本。

KEDA.sh与Kubernetes和领先的无服务器框架(例如Knative)无缝集成。它支持各种语言,包括Node.js、Java和Python。

使用KEDA.sh的主要优势包括:

  • 减少管理开销
  • 提高应用程序弹性
  • 简化事件驱动的架构
  • 优化成本和资源利用